In the world of professional sports, success is not only measured by results on the field. The identity and values of a sports club are much more than words on a wall: they are the engine that drives every decision, every training and every interaction between professionals.

“According to a recent study from Stanford University, “sports organizations with a strong and well-defined culture experience 32% more commitment from their technical staff and 28% less staff turnover”

The transformative power of organizational culture

As Johan Cruyff said: “Organizational culture is the invisible operating system that determines how a sports club actually works.” This reality is embodied in every aspect of daily work, from training sessions to team meetings.

From theory to practice

Ajax Amsterdam provides us with an exceptional example with its “Ajax DNA” program, which integrates its core values into every aspect of daily work. This systematic approach has demonstrated how organizational culture can become a tangible competitive advantage.

In the words of Pep Guardiola: “Values aren't just words on the wall, they're the decisions we make when no one is watching.”

Impact on professional development

According to the Deloitte Sports Business Group report, 76% of sports practitioners consider that alignment with the club's values is crucial for their long-term professional development.

Conclusion

A club's identity and values are powerful tools that, when properly implemented, transform the way professionals approach their daily responsibilities. Sustainable success in sport requires a strong organizational culture that inspires, guides and empowers all members of the team.
